Banisteriopsis caapi is a South American liana of the Malpighiaceae, useful in a variety of different disciplines including soap-making and (apparently for several thousand years) traditional Amazonian indigenous medicine. Reaching roughly fifteen to twenty metres high in the wild, this multi branched and distinctively twisting vine puts out smooth, deep green oval-ish leaves and delicate, white to pink flowers (approximately two and a half millimetres long and twelve millimetres in diameter) which usually only bloom infrequently.
Caapi thrives in moist, humus-rich soil in warm tropical to semi-tropical climates and is native to the rainforests of Brazil, Colombia, Ecuador and Peru. Close relatives include Banisteriopsis membranifolia and Banisteriopsis muricata.
